An appeal has halted plans for a sports centre and swimming pool on grounds at King William's College.
Plans for the facility were previously approved, but will now be looked into further following an appeal request by the Southern Swimming Pool Board.
They claim there is no need for a 50m pool in that location, as it can't be deemed a community pool, nor an effective training one.
The board also believes the proposal 'undermines the actions of the Area Plan' and the purpose of the pool is unclear.
